The Hietanen family, consisting of parents Alexandra and Ryan, has been on a life-altering journey since the birth of their son Landon, who was diagnosed with level 3 autism. At just six years old, Landon’s needs have prompted Alexandra and Ryan to make significant changes in their lives, including their careers, finances, and daily routines. The couple, both registered nurses, has devoted years to therapy, advocacy, and navigating the challenges that come with raising a child with disabilities.

In a recent interview with PEOPLE, Alexandra reflected on the profound sacrifices their family has made to provide Landon with the therapies and support he requires. One notable instance was captured in a TikTok video that showed Ryan selling one of his treasured Pokémon cards to help fund Landon’s stem cell treatment. Though this act resonated emotionally with viewers, Alexandra emphasised that it was just a small glimpse into the years of dedication and hardship that preceded it.

“The sacrifices that often go unnoticed are the hardest,” Alexandra, 42, explained. “We have adapted our professional lives and financial priorities to ensure that Landon has every opportunity for success.” For the Hietanens, this journey is not merely about seeking a miraculous solution but rather exploring every available option to boost Landon’s development.
Each milestone Landon achieves is celebrated by his family as a significant victory, highlighting the hard work and patience required to reach those moments. “He is the happiest little boy,” Alexandra states proudly. “Each achievement is a testament to our efforts and the support we have provided him through various therapies.”
Despite their extensive background in healthcare, making decisions regarding Landon’s care has not been easy. The couple dedicated themselves to researching treatment possibilities, ultimately deciding to pursue stem cell therapy. Alexandra underscored the gravity of their choices. “I wish people understood that every family’s journey is unique, and these decisions are complicated and often emotionally charged,” she said.
Alexandra described the often unseen reality of parenting a child with autism. Behind the scenes, their lives are filled with therapy appointments, sleepless nights, and the constant need to advocate for Landon’s requirements. “There are so many challenges we face that many don’t see,” she noted. “However, like many families in similar situations, we would choose this path again in an instant.”
The couple’s supportive relationship has been a cornerstone throughout their journey. Alexandra refers to Ryan, 39, as her “steady calm,” emphasising the importance of teamwork in navigating the ups and downs of parenting. They have consistently reassured one another that their shared goal is to provide the best life for Landon. “Ultimately, our actions are driven by love for our children and hope for Landon’s future,” she explained.
The viral TikTok not only showcased their emotional sacrifices but also connected them with a global community. Feedback poured in from various individuals, including parents and collectors, providing encouragement and affirming the kindness that still exists in the world. Alexandra shared how these interactions have turned their experience into something greater than just their own struggles. “Having our story touch others has been an unforeseen blessing,” she said, reflecting on the universal desire among parents to make the best decisions for their children.
As they continue navigating the complexities of Landon’s autism, the Hietanen family hopes that by sharing their story, they can shed light on the often invisible sacrifices that parents of children with disabilities endure. They aim to foster understanding and support for families living similar experiences, encouraging a message of resilience, advocacy, and above all, unconditional love.
